Output f32f594280922a2a721f98a9cf9a53c7ef638a93ce2041015908009bc5c58d0e:1861

value
1153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f841aae904057aed69f68a2836bfd47866c9d9cbf6ebfb3b212e8ed75d54a2f5
address
bc1plpq646gyq4aw660k3g5rd0750pnvnkwt7m4lkwep968dwh255t6ser2q7l
transaction
f32f594280922a2a721f98a9cf9a53c7ef638a93ce2041015908009bc5c58d0e
confirmations
117013
spent
true